Provision anatomy

Legal test 1

Aggregator contribution and worker eligibility depend on the scheme, prescribed rates/turnover basis and verified digital work records.

Implementation control

Trigger

Document the facts that activate section 114: schemes for gig workers and platform workers.

Coverage and jurisdiction

Identify establishment, employee/worker category, appropriate Government, First Schedule threshold and territorial authority.

Decision owner

Assign a named owner for schemes and registration for unorganised, gig and platform workers; identify HR, payroll, finance, legal, contractor and authorised-signatory roles.

Evidence pack

portal registration, occupation/aggregator data, eligibility, contribution reconciliation, scheme benefit and grievance evidence.

System control

Map the provision to payroll/HRIS, contractor, portal, accounting and document-retention controls; prevent manual overrides without approval.

Consequence and remedy

Identify benefit denial, contribution/cess recovery, interest, damages, appeal, court/authority forum, penalty and prosecution implications separately.

Worked control example

A compliance owner is assessing schemes for gig workers and platform workers. The owner first fixes the applicable Chapter and appropriate Government, opens the official section and linked subordinate law, identifies the employee/worker and establishment facts, records the calculation or decision in a dated working paper, completes the prescribed portal/form step, and retains acknowledgement and payment/order evidence. A later rule, scheme, regulation, exemption or State notification is checked before the file is closed.

Practical questions

Can the section heading alone be used as the legal test?

No. Read every subsection, clause, proviso, explanation, Schedule reference and notified scheme/rule.

Are the Central Rules always the complete answer?

No. Determine the appropriate Government and check State rules, schemes, EPFO/ESIC regulations, rates, exemptions and authority notifications.

How should later changes be controlled?

Maintain a provision-level legal-freshness register recording source, effective date, system impact, owner, implementation evidence and next review.
